The Historical Significance of Height in Hair
Throughout history, hairstyles have served as powerful symbols of status, identity, and cultural expression. The desire to give height as a hairdo is deeply rooted in this tradition. In ancient Egypt, elaborate wigs and towering headdresses were worn by royalty and the elite to signify their elevated position in society. Similarly, in 18th-century Europe, extravagant hairstyles like the pouf, which could reach incredible heights, were a symbol of wealth and extravagance.
In the mid-20th century, the bouffant and beehive became iconic hairstyles, popularized by celebrities like Jackie Kennedy and Audrey Hepburn. These styles, which relied on teasing, backcombing, and copious amounts of hairspray, were a way for women to express their individuality and embrace a sense of glamour. Modern Techniques to Give Height As A Hairdo
Today, the techniques used to give height as a hairdo have evolved, but the underlying principle remains the same: to create the illusion of volume and lift. Modern stylists have access to a wide range of products and tools that can help achieve this goal without the damage associated with traditional methods like excessive backcombing. Here are some popular techniques:
- Root Lifting Products: Sprays, mousses, and gels specifically designed to lift the hair at the roots can provide a foundation for volume. These products often contain polymers that create a lightweight hold, preventing the hair from falling flat.
- Volumizing Shampoos and Conditioners: These products are formulated to cleanse the hair without weighing it down, leaving it feeling fuller and more voluminous. They often contain ingredients like protein and amino acids that strengthen the hair shaft.
- Blow-Drying Techniques: The way you blow-dry your hair can significantly impact its volume. Using a round brush to lift the hair at the roots while blow-drying can create lasting lift. Flipping your head upside down while drying can also add volume.
- Teasing (Backcombing): While excessive backcombing can damage the hair, a small amount of teasing at the crown can provide a subtle lift. It’s important to use a fine-toothed comb and gentle strokes to avoid breakage.
- Hair Extensions: For those with fine or thin hair, clip-in or tape-in extensions can instantly add volume and length. When applied correctly, they can blend seamlessly with your natural hair.

Styling Products for Height
Achieving the perfect voluminous hairstyle often relies heavily on the right styling products. Several options cater to different hair types and desired levels of hold. Here’s a breakdown:
- Mousse: Provides lightweight volume and hold, ideal for fine to medium hair. Apply to damp hair from roots to ends before blow-drying.
- Root Lift Spray: Targets the roots to create lift and volume at the scalp. Spray directly onto the roots of damp or dry hair and style as desired.
- Volumizing Hairspray: Offers a strong hold and adds volume to the overall style. Choose a flexible hold hairspray to avoid stiffness.
- Dry Shampoo: Absorbs excess oil and adds texture, making it a great option for creating volume on second-day hair.
- Texturizing Spray: Adds grit and definition to the hair, enhancing volume and creating a tousled look.
Face Shape and Hair Height
When deciding how much height to give height as a hairdo, it’s important to consider your face shape. Different face shapes are flattered by different styles. Here are some general guidelines:
- Oval Face: An oval face is considered the most versatile shape and can pull off a wide range of hairstyles. Experiment with different levels of height and volume to find what you like best.
- Round Face: Adding height to the crown of the head can help to elongate a round face. Avoid styles that are too wide at the sides, as this can make the face appear even rounder.
- Square Face: Soft, layered styles with volume at the crown can help to soften the angles of a square face. Avoid styles that are too blunt or geometric.
- Heart-Shaped Face: Styles with volume at the chin can help to balance out a heart-shaped face. Avoid styles that are too top-heavy, as this can accentuate the wide forehead.
- Long Face: Styles with width at the sides can help to make a long face appear shorter. Avoid styles that are too flat or lack volume.
Maintaining Height and Volume Throughout the Day
Creating a voluminous hairstyle is one thing, but maintaining it throughout the day can be a challenge. Here are some tips to help your style last:
- Use the Right Products: Choose styling products that are designed to provide long-lasting hold and volume.
- Avoid Touching Your Hair: Touching your hair can transfer oils and flatten the style.
- Use a Hairspray with Flexible Hold: A flexible hold hairspray will allow your hair to move naturally without losing its shape.
- Tease Sparingly: If you choose to tease your hair, do so sparingly and gently to avoid damage.
- Consider a Root Touch-Up: If your roots tend to fall flat, consider using a root touch-up product to add lift and volume throughout the day.
